HJS Aftermarket Aircraft Components Expands Inventory

HJS Aftermarket Aircraft Components (HJS) has announced a significant expansion of its parts inventory through the acquisition of four additional aircraft. This strategic move aims to enhance its global inventory of high-quality aftermarket components, which are crucial for maintaining and servicing business aviation fleets.

The newly acquired aircraft include a King Air 350ER, Falcon 50, Hawker 4000, and Challenger 300, all of which are currently undergoing dismantling at various locations. This initiative not only increases HJS's inventory but also underscores the growing demand for reliable aftermarket components in the executive aviation sector.

According to HJS, the addition of these aircraft will allow the company to provide a wider range of parts, thereby improving service levels for operators and maintenance providers in the business aviation market. The King Air 350ER, known for its versatility and performance, along with the Falcon 50, Hawker 4000, and Challenger 300, all represent popular choices among business jet operators. The availability of parts from these models will be beneficial for ensuring the longevity and reliability of existing fleets.
